Properties to view… Architect Sir Edwin Lutyens’ designs

Often referred to as the ‘greatest British architect’, Sir Edwin Lutyens has designed multiple English country houses. Lutyens is best known for his imaginative style with most of his designs influenced by the Arts & Craft movement.
